How To Fix DRF_OUTBOUND085 - Replication model &1 is not stored or inactive in customizing


DRF_OUTBOUND085 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: DRF_OUTBOUND - Messages for Outbound Services

  • Message number: 085

  • Message text: Replication model &1 is not stored or inactive in customizing

    The SAP error message DRF_OUTBOUND085 indicates that the replication model specified is either not stored or is inactive in the customizing settings. This error typically occurs in the context of SAP's Data Replication Framework (DRF), which is used for replicating master data across different systems.
    
    Cause: Replication Model Not Defined: The specified replication model does not exist in the system. Replication Model Inactive: The replication model exists but is marked as inactive, meaning it cannot be used for replication processes. Incorrect Configuration: There may be a misconfiguration in the settings related to the replication model.
    Solution: To resolve the error, follow these steps: Check Replication Model: Go to the transaction code DRFOUT (or navigate through the menu: Logistics > Central Functions > Master Data Synchronization > Data Replication Framework > Maintain Replication Model).
